Referral History and Update:

At its last meeting on November 21, 2025, the Governing Board of the Green Empowerment Zone received an update on the launch of the website (greenempowermentzone.org) for the Green Empowerment Zone. Golden Shovel Agency (GSA) provides content creation tools with their services. They can provide quick website updates and assist in social media accounts for the GEZ. Also, the Governing Board members can publish their own personal work and host webinars on the website that will be available underneath their individual profiles (see attached). Since the last meeting, County staff have met with GSA to respond to Governing Board requests for updates to their website. They have also met with GSA to review draft set of social media posts and lead analytics information (see attached).
